Definitions for pillage

Definitions for (noun) pillage

Main entry: plundering, pillage, pillaging

Definition: the act of stealing valuable things from a place

Usage: the plundering of the Parthenon; his plundering of the great authors


Main entry: swag, plunder, pillage, prize, booty, loot, dirty money

Definition: goods or money obtained illegally


Definitions for (verb) pillage

Main entry: rifle, ransack, reave, plunder, pillage, despoil, foray, loot, strip

Definition: steal goods; take as spoils

Usage: During the earthquake people looted the stores that were deserted by their owners
